How Jack Burdock's Batting Average Compares to Similar Players

Jack Burdock posted a career Batting Average of .251, near the league average of .263 — a profile that tracked closely with league norms. His best Batting Average season came in 1883, posting .330, near the league average of .351 that year. The lowest point came in 1891 at .083, well below the league average of .270 that year, a partial season. Production slipped through the final seasons. The figure moved from .257 in 1887 to .142 in 1888 and .083 in 1891. The decline marked the closing chapter of the career. Some season-to-season variance runs through the career line, but the career average tracked near league norms across 18 seasons.
